About Us
Creating Opportunities for Guatemalans is a Canadian Registered Charity and US Registered Charity whose mission is to advance education by providing educational support through sponsorships and after-school programs to children living in poverty.
Our vision is to empower Guatemalans to break the cycle of poverty and achieve self-sufficiency through education.

Mission Statement
Creating Opportunities for Guatemalans mission is to lead Guatemalans out of poverty through education by providing sponsorship and an after-school support program for young students plus literacy and vocational training for adults.
Description
Creating Opportunities for Guatemalans is a charity educating Guatemalans as a means to a better future. Through our organization, donors provide monthly sponsorship to children living in poverty to enable them stay in school. Our charity provides an after-school support program to ensure that these children receive help to do their homework and to study for their exams. We also provide additional teaching time, with a focus on critical thinking, and we teach the children English to provide them with this much needed skill.
